Resumo: Transport modes are known worldwide because they represent a great challenge in the searchfor sustainability, where one of these issues refers to the constant problems of congestion that cause the increase of atmospheric emissions, harmful to the environment and to health. Thus, some cities stand out for proposing innovative solutions, being the bicycle lanes one of the already consolidated bets as a sustainable modal, seen in examples like Amsterdam, Copenhagen and Stockholm. Therefore, urban planning is an essential management tool for cities to develop their pursuit of sustainability, making possible the updating and implementation of master plans, mobility plans and cycling plans, which are emphasized due to their impact potential. In this way, the objective was to evaluate the impact on sustainability through the implantation of the bike path, conducting studies, diagnosis and analysis in the city of Passo Fundo - Rio Grande do Sul. In order to facilitate the stages of the study, was carried out a data collection with the application of the geographic information system and presented together with a set of indicators, allowing the creation of a methodology that becomes a tool for public and private managers to apply in their areas of actions. Through the geoprocessed information system in the ArcGIS software, the creation of future and current scenarios is performed, which allows the multitemporal analysis of the variations proposed by the plans and quantifying the impacts of these actions on sustainability. In this study, the impacts of the implantation of the bike path were verified in the ambits of environmental, social and economic sustainability, demonstrated in the application of the methodology in a medium sized city and obtaining thematic maps as results for the diagnosis and quantification of the indicators to the final evaluation of the impacts on sustainability, highlighting the positive points to the construction of the bike path.
